  13. Ultrasonic Jewelry Cleaner
  14. Are you tired looking at shabby, dull jewelry that no longer sparkles? Ultrasonic jewelry cleaner is your answer! This powerful tool uses ultrasonic wave technology to remove dirt and grime from all the hard-to reach places, such as settings and chains.

    Forget expensive trips to the jeweler for a professional cleaning - now you can get that sparkling shine at home! You can use it in no time at all - just fill it with water, and the ultrasonic waves will do the rest.

What is a deep cleaning?

A deep clean covers all surfaces: baseboards to walls, doors and windows. It also involves dusting, vacuuming, mopping, scrubbing, polishing, washing dishes, wiping counters, sweeping floors, and emptying trash cans.
